Output 52af3708cec279af12b13a6c93866517ae0cfbf436dfd2ffea6013252576134c:94

value
5154
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dabac40206d75158908f89b5139d96549f76ad25d9974b9d86bce2b8761c67ae
address
ltc1pm2avgqsx6ag43yy03x6388vk2j0hdtf9mxt5h8vxhn3tsasuv7hq7uaeyk
transaction
52af3708cec279af12b13a6c93866517ae0cfbf436dfd2ffea6013252576134c
spent
true